The Legend of Pudding Street

May 30, 2021October 17, 2022 Gordon Harris1 Comment
Pudding Street thief

"We turn our eyes below and at our feet, Lies in peace old Pudding Street, So named because a pudding left to dry Was stolen by some tipsy passers by. These later years from vulgar names have shrunk, And called it High because the thieves were drunk."
